Abstract
Recently, the novel approach to Hough Transform (HT) calculation, regarded to as the Hough-Green Transform (HGT), was proposed. This approach is based on tracing object contours on bitonal imagery; therefore it is usually much more computationally effective than the Standard HT (SHT) on objects with a large number of interior pixels, as the acceleration is proportional to area by circumference ratio. Although the purely software sequential HGT implementation is very effective compared to the SHT and the Radon transform based alternatives, the algorithm allows designing a parallel and scalable real-time architecture.
